Energy efficiency is another key feature that sets smart kitchen appliances apart from traditional ones. Modern appliances are designed with advanced sensors and algorithms that optimize power usage based on real-time needs. For example, smart refrigerators can adjust cooling levels depending on how often the door is opened, while induction cooktops heat only the cookware rather than the surrounding surface, reducing wasted energy. These innovations not only lower electricity bills but also contribute to environmental conservation by minimizing unnecessary energy consumption.

Smart refrigerators are among the most innovative appliances in modern kitchens. Equipped with internal cameras and inventory tracking systems, they allow users to monitor food supplies in real time. This helps reduce food waste by ensuring that items are used before they expire. Some models can even suggest recipes based on available ingredients, making meal planning more efficient. Additionally, smart refrigerators can notify users when groceries are running low, streamlining the shopping process and saving valuable time.
Water-saving technologies are also being incorporated into smart kitchen appliances, further enhancing their sustainability. Smart dishwashers, for example, can detect the level of dirt on dishes and adjust water usage accordingly. This ensures that only the necessary amount of water is used for each cycle, reducing waste and conserving resources. Similarly, smart faucets can regulate water flow and temperature, providing precise control and preventing unnecessary usage.
